Curb Repair in Des Moines, IA
Curb rep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the integrity of a property's driveway, sidewalk, and other paved or concrete surfaces along the curb line. This includes fixing cracks, potholes, uneven areas, and damaged edges to ensure safety, improve curb appeal, and prevent further deterioration. Projects may involve patching damaged sections, leveling uneven surfaces, or replacing sections of concrete or asphalt that have become compromised over time. Homeowners considering curb repair should understand the extent of damage and whether repairs are sufficient or if replacement might be necessary to achieve a durable and long-lasting result.
Before requesting curb repair, property owners often want to know what types of issues are covered and what the process involves. It’s helpful to assess the condition of the curb and identify specific problem areas, such as large cracks or significant settling. Understanding the scope of work needed can assist in planning and budgeting for repairs or replacements. Clear communication about the existing damage and desired outcomes can help ensure the repair work aligns with property maintenance goals and enhances the overall appearance and safety of the property.

Curb Repair Questions
What types of curb damage can be repaired? Common repairs include cracks, chips, uneven surfaces, and minor structural issues to restore curb appearance and function.
Is curb repair suitable for all driveway materials? Yes, curb repair methods can be applied to concrete, brick, stone, and other common driveway materials.
What are signs that curb repair may be needed? Visible cracks, crumbling edges, shifting, or uneven surfaces indicate that curb repair could be necessary.
How does curb repair improve property value? Restoring curb appeal with repairs can enhance the overall look and safety of a property’s exterior.
